In 1948 two local women volunteered to run a kindergarten service two-days per week in the St Andrews Presbyterian Church Hall, Blacktown. The following year, a Ladies Auxiliary was formed from the Blacktown Progress Association providing a five- day week kindergarten service. In 1953, the Ladies Auxiliary called a public meeting and formed Blacktown Kindergarten Association, and by 2000 become Incorporated. The organisation later renamed to Children First Incorporated and up until 2011 was governed voluntarily by parents and community members. In 2012, as part of the company’s strategic growth strategy, the organisation transitioned to a company limited by guarantee and is now governed by a board of directors. The legal entity name was registered as Growing Potential Ltd, however, remained trading as Children First. Growing Potential Ltd is currently managed by a Chief Executive Officer and three Executive Managers overseeing Administration, Children’s Services and Family Services. The board of directors consists of seven members. Growing Potential Ltd is a registered charity with the Australian Charities and Not-for-Profits Commission (ACNC). We also have DGR and PBI status, meaning donations over $2 are tax deductible.
